UFO is not only one of the UK s most prolific rock bands, but its music has also influenced an entire generation of modern metal groups like Iron Maiden and Metallica. Hot N Live: Chrysalis Live Anthology 1974 - 1983 is a double-disc set packed with rare live tracks from these hard rock pioneers. It features eight previously unreleased performances recorded at the band s legendary 1980 Marquee shows, including the songs "Too Hot to Handle" and "Love to Love."

The first disc covers guitarist Michael Schenker s tenure with the group (1974-1978), while the second disc highlights the period with guitarist Paul "Tonka" Chapman (1980-1983). Hot "N" Live includes new liner notes based on a recent interview with bassist and founding member Pete Way.
